#49997a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49997a is composed of 28.6% red, 60% green and 47.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 156.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 44.3%. #49997a color hex could be obtained by blending #92fff4 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#49997a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49997a has RGB values of R:73, G:153, B:122 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4823418.

Shades and Tints of #49997a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030706 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#49997a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7672 is the less saturated color, while #03df8a is the most saturated one.
